Grant Description

On November 14, 2022, during a meeting with the Chief Minister of Punjab Chaudhry Parvez Elahi, the Chinese Consul General in Lahore Zhao Shiren handed over a check worth PKR 30 million on behalf of the Guangdong Provincial Government. The donation was intended to assist with post-disaster reconstruction efforts in the province.
